> On Mon, 2011-12-05 at 19:38 +0100, W P Blatchley wrote: > > Is the font chosen just the first one RUfl encounters > > (alphabetically?) that has a match? > > Pretty much, yes. See: > http://source.netsurf-browser.org/trunk/rufl/src/rufl_init.c?revision=9792&view=markup#l1061 Just to explain the motivation behind this design: the substitution table is 65K, and there are 18 weight-slant combinations. I wanted RUfl to have small memory usage, so adding a table for each weight- slant would have taken too much space. Perhaps a different data structure or approach would be possible. It wouldn't be difficult to construct the table in a different order from alphabetical though. James
